Sisalwool is a semi-rigid, natural fibre insulation batt composed of sheep’s wool and sisal fibres. Suitable for both thermal and acoustic applications, it boasts superior breathability and exceptional usability.
Key benefits:
- Vapour Permeable: allowing traditional stone buildings to breathe and moisture to transfer
- Flexible Fitting: can be friction-fitted between rafters, ceiling joists, floor joists and studwork
- Safe to Touch: can be handled safely, comfortably and does not cause skin irritation
- Acoustic Excellence: offers proven Class A sound absorption and meets Building Regulations Part E requirements
- Low Carbon: using natural and circular economy materials such as recycled sisal and waste wool
- Universally Compatible: suitable for both new build and retrofit, including historic buildings
- Fully Recyclable: can be returned at end of life for reprocessing
Product Specifications
| Density | 40kg/m³ |
| Thickness | 100mm |
| Length | 1200mm |
| Width | 370mm or 570mm |
Technical Specifications
| Property | Standard | Unit | Value |
|---|---|---|---|
| Thermal conductivity | BS EN 12667 | W/mk | 0.039 |
| Water absorption | EN 1609 | Wp kg/m² | 8.72 |
| Water vapour diffusion | BS EN 12086:2013 | µ (MU) | 1.46 |
| Reaction to fire | EN 13501-1 | Euroclass | E |
| Sound absorption | EN ISO 354 and EN ISO 11654 | αw | 1.00 (Class A) |
| Moth resistance | ISO 3998 (EAD 040005-00-1201) | according to EAD | Pass |

Sound Absorption
| Sisalwool Silent Thickness | Sound Absorption Coefficient | Rating |
|---|---|---|
| 100mm | 1.00 αw | Class A |
| 50mm | 0.85 (H) αw | Class B |
In accordance with BS EN ISO 354:2003 and BS EN ISO 11654:1997.
Solid Timber Floor Build Up*
| Joist Size | Stud Spacing | Plasterboard | Chipboard | Sisalwool Silent Thickness | Sound Reduction (Rw) |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 200 x 50mm | 450mm | 1 x 12.5mm standard wallboard | 1 x 22mm T&G | 100mm | 42dB |
In accordance with BS EN ISO 10140-2:2021 for requirements of Building Regulations Part E. UKAS Lab Certificate: 82747
Internal Partition Wall Build Up*
| Timber Stud Size | Stud Spacing | Plasterboard | Sisalwool Silent Thickness | Sound Reduction (Rw) |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 63mm | 600mm | 2 x 12.5mm standard wallboard | 50mm | 40dB |
In accordance with BS EN ISO 10140-2:2021 for requirements of Building Regulations Part E. UKAS Lab Certificate: 82604
*Testing was conducted on basic build ups. Additional materials will significantly
improve dB reduction, eg: 15mm plasterboard will likely provide an additional
2dB reduction
